description |
This study presents the experimental results of earthing systems under steady state and transient conditions. To date, only a limited amount of research has been documented regarding earthing systems under transient conditions. In this work, earthing systems with specific dimensions are constructed. The apparent soil resistivity is measured using the Wenner method. Master Curves (MC) and Genetic Algorithms (GA) are used for interpretation in order to determine the soil parameters. The earth resistance of the earthing system is measured using the Fall-of-Potential method as described in the standards. |
